Crafting a Killer Pitch Deck: Tips for Every Platform
Creating your compelling pitch deck is critical for securing investment or collaboration . It’s just about a beautifully designed presentation; it’s about tailoring your message for each platform. For instance, presenting to potential backers requires your different approach than posting your deck on LinkedIn . Consider these key points when building for multiple channels:
For In-Person Presentations: Focus on your clear narrative and dynamic visuals. Be ready to address questions thoroughly and demonstrate your enthusiasm .
For Online Platforms (e.g., AngelList): Keep sections concise and easy to understand. Leverage keywords effectively to improve searchability.
For Email Pitches: Include the PDF version of the deck and provide your brief summary of core highlights.
For Social Media: Break the deck into smaller chunks and share them regularly with engaging captions.
Remember, responsiveness is paramount to triumph in the current investment landscape. Your well-crafted and channel-optimized pitch deck boosts the chances of securing the crucial deal.
